Christian Vadalà
chrvadala
React & Node.js developer; Author of react-svg-pan-zoom
Languages
Top Repositories
:eyes: A React component that adds pan and zoom features to SVG
Javascript isomorphic 2D affine transformations written in ES6 syntax. Manipulate transformation matrices with this totally tested library!
Bluetooth Low Energy (BLE) library written with pure Node.js (no bindings) - baked by Bluez via DBus
music-beat-detector is a library that analyzes a music stream and detects any beat. It can be used to control lights or any magic effect by the music wave.
Curated list of awesome technology protocols with a reference to official RFCs
Creates a PCM 16 bit Little Endian Stream from a mp3 file or youtube video
Repositories
36music-beat-detector is a library that analyzes a music stream and detects any beat. It can be used to control lights or any magic effect by the music wave.
Javascript isomorphic 2D affine transformations written in ES6 syntax. Manipulate transformation matrices with this totally tested library!
Hello, this is Christian Vadalà's website. Here you can find a list of open source projects, backed by React, Node.JS and AWS technologies.
Bluetooth Low Energy (BLE) library written with pure Node.js (no bindings) - baked by Bluez via DBus
setup-my-pc.sh is a simple script that configures personal computers, virtual machines and servers with some common tools. It fastify the setup of a new development environment.
Curated list of awesome technology protocols with a reference to official RFCs
:eyes: A React component that adds pan and zoom features to SVG
Aggregate fn is a tiny Javascript utility that groups together multiple async operations.
Connector able to download weather data from an Oregon Scientific EMR211X station, leveraging on Bluetooth Low Energy connection
MQTT dispatcher is a library that extends MQTT.js and allows to route incoming messages on a specific handler, according to defined routing rules.
Utility library that simplify testing of Node.js components that interacts with Kafka broker.
GitHub default configuration folder
Creates a PCM 16 bit Little Endian Stream from a mp3 file or youtube video
Potree Converter utility packed as Docker Container
Github actions that automates some common scenarios.
:wrench: Convert your React Class Component to Functional Component and vice-versa
:see_no_evil: Docker container with Decoder for password encoding of Cisco VPN client
:computer: This project intends to collect common docker-compose use cases. Each example can be used as a boilerplate.
AWS CloudFormation stacks that speed-up projects development.
Node.js library to control Adafruit NeoPixel based on ws2812 led family
:sparkles: A tiny command line tool that extract `package.json` version and generate `export const VERSION='...'` file. Useful when you want to package your software version.
Find biconnected component in a graph using algorithm by John Hopcroft and Robert Tarjan
This React experimental project avoid JSX and split logic from template and style using 3 different files.
:yum: A suggested React + Redux projects structure.
Hello, I'm Christian
Given a stream of data, this algorithm returns (for every added value) the current max value.
:game_die: Sudoku solver written in golang
A working version of CHIP-tools by NextThingCo.
Prolog algorithm that applies the method of analytic tableaux and creates a graphical representation of a propositional tableau
Visual plan designer